The Role

Gradial is hiring a Senior Integrations Engineer to expand our enterprise MarTech integrations practice. In this role, you will design and ship production-ready integrations across a wide range of marketing platforms, content systems, and customer data tools for complex enterprise environments.

You will work directly with customers, product, and engineering to turn messy real-world stacks into reliable connectors that help global brands operationalize AI-native content workflows. This role is ideal for a high-agency engineer who is comfortable moving between well-known platforms and custom internal systems, and who can bring structure to ambiguity without waiting for perfect requirements.

What You’ll Own
  • Architect, build, and maintain integrations across ESPs, CDPs, marketing automation platforms, CMSs, DAMs, and adjacent MarTech systems
  • Lead technical discovery with enterprise customers to understand system landscapes, define integration requirements, and shape practical delivery plans
  • Translate custom or poorly documented environments into clean, scalable integration designs with clear technical documentation
  • Own the full integration lifecycle, including API evaluation, authentication flows, data mapping, sync logic, testing, monitoring, and production rollout
  • Partner with product and platform engineering to ensure integrations are resilient, observable, and performant at enterprise scale
  • Contribute reusable patterns, shared libraries, and connector framework improvements that accelerate support for future platforms
  • Serve as a trusted technical partner for customer stakeholders, connecting business requirements to sound engineering decisions
  • Identify edge cases, platform constraints, and implementation risks early, then drive pragmatic solutions through delivery
What We’re Looking For
  • 5+ years of software engineering experience, with meaningful time spent building and shipping external system integrations in production
  • Strong experience working across APIs and integration patterns, including REST, webhooks, OAuth, pagination, rate limiting, retries, and error handling
  • Hands‑on experience delivering MarTech implementations or integrations for enterprise customers, ideally in an agency, systems integrator, or customer‑facing SaaS environment
  • Broad familiarity with the MarTech ecosystem, including customer engagement platforms, customer data tools, content systems, analytics platforms, and workflow automation tools
  • Ability to operate effectively in ambiguous enterprise environments where requirements evolve, documentation is incomplete, and systems are heavily customized
  • Strong communication skills with the ability to work directly with technical and non‑technical stakeholders and explain tradeoffs clearly
  • Proven ownership mindset with a track record of driving projects end to end and making progress without heavy process or detailed specs
  • Solid engineering judgment around maintainability, reliability, testing, and production readiness
